COMMITTEE FOR PURCHASE FROM PEOPLE WHO ARE BLIND OR SEVERELY DISABLED

 
Procurement List; Additions and Deletion

AGENCY: Committee for Purchase From People Who Are Blind or Severely 
Disabled.

ACTION: Additions to and Deletion from the Procurement List.

-----------------------------------------------------------------------

SUMMARY: This action adds to the Procurement List a product and 
services to be furnished by nonprofit agencies employing persons who 
are blind or have other severe disabilities, and deletes from the 
Procurement List a service previously furnished by such agencies.

Effective Date: July 20, 2008.

SUPPLEMENTARY INFORMATION:

Additions

    On March 28, April 18 and April 25, 2008 the Committee for Purchase 
From People Who Are Blind or Severely Disabled published notice (73 
FR16639; 21107; 22324) of proposed additions to the Procurement List.
    After consideration of the material presented to it concerning 
capability of qualified nonprofit agencies to provide the product and 
services and impact of the additions on the current or most recent 
contractors, the Committee has determined that the product and services 
listed below are suitable for procurement by the Federal Government 
under 41 U.S.C. 46-48c and 41 CFR 51-2.4.

Regulatory Flexibility Act Certification

    I certify that the following action will not have a significant 
impact on a substantial number of small entities. The major factors 
considered for this certification were:
    1. The action will not result in any additional reporting, 
recordkeeping or other compliance requirements for small entities other 
than the small organizations that will furnish the product and services 
to the Government.
    2. The action will result in authorizing small entities to furnish 
the product and services to the Government.
    3. There are no known regulatory alternatives which would 
accomplish the objectives of the Javits-Wagner-O'Day Act (41 U.S.C. 46-
48c) in connection with the product and services proposed for addition 
to the Procurement List.

End of Certification

    Accordingly, the following product and services are added to the 
Procurement List:

Product

Bag, Fecal Incontinent

NSN: 6530-00-NSH-0045--Large
NPA: Work, Inc., North Quincy, MA
Coverage: C-List for the requirement of the Department of Veterans 
Affairs, National Acquisition Center, Hines, IL
Contracting Activity: Department of Veterans Affairs, National 
Acquisition Center, Hines, IL

Services

Service Type/Location: Custodial Services, Andersen Air Force Base, 
Basewide, APO AP, GU.
NPA: Able Industries of the Pacific, Santa Rita, GU.
Contracting Activity: U.S. Air Force, Anderson Air Force Base, 36th 
Contracting Squadron, APO AP, GU.
Service Type/Location: Mailroom Operations, Immigration & Customs 
Enforcement, 1100 Center Parkway (Camp Creek Business Center), 180 
Spring Street, 2150 Park Lake Drive, Atlanta, GA.
NPA: WORKTEC, Jonesboro, GA.
Contracting Activity: U.S. Department of Homeland Security, 
Immigration and Customs Enforcement, Washington, DC.

Deletion

    On April 11, 2008, the Committee for Purchase From People Who Are 
Blind or Severely Disabled published notice (73 FR19808) of proposed 
deletions to the Procurement List.
    After consideration of the relevant matter presented, the Committee 
has determined that the service listed below are no longer suitable for 
procurement by the Federal Government under41 U.S.C. 46-48c and 41 CFR 
51-2.4.

Regulatory Flexibility Act Certification

    I certify that the following action will not have a significant 
impact on a substantial number of small entities. The major factors 
considered for this certification were:

[[Page 35118]]

    1. The action should not result in additional reporting, 
recordkeeping or other compliance requirements for small entities.
    2. The action may result in authorizing small entities to furnish 
the services to the Government.
    3. There are no known regulatory alternatives which would 
accomplish the objectives of the Javits-Wagner-O'Day Act (41 U.S.C. 46-
48c) in connection with the service deleted from the Procurement List.

End of Certification

    Accordingly, the following service is deleted from the Procurement 
List:

Service:

Service Type/Location: Janitorial/Custodial, Curlew Conservation 
Center, Colville National Forest, Curlew, WA.
NPA: Ferry County Community Services, Republic, WA.
Contracting Activity: U.S. Department of Agriculture, Colville 
National Forest, Colville, WA.
